Voith supplies Papierfabrik Palm with complete BlueLine stock preparation line for new build project in Aalen

At the beginning of June 2019, the green light was given for the construction of the new Papierfabrik Palm paper mill for the production of testliner and corrugated baseboard. Voith will be supplying the stock preparation line for the project and has to this end designed one of the largest and most advanced BlueLine systems worldwide.

Sappi chooses ABB to help boost output and ease environmental impact

Sappi has chosen ABB to supply engineering, procurement and construction for the electrical, control and instrumentation portion of their project Vulindlela. The project is an ambitious plan to increase mill production by approximately 14 percent while reducing the pulp mill’s environmental impact. Due for completion in the winter of 2020, the project includes the design, supply, installation and commissioning of all electrical and automation equipment at Sappi’s Saiccor Mill located in Umkomaas, South Africa.

SupremeFilm: Voith launches new premium polyurethane roll cover for film presses

With SupremeFilm, Voith is enhancing its product range for film presses with a new high-performance roll cover made from polyurethane (PU). To positively influence paper characteristics like printability, coating and starch are applied to the paper in the coating and sizing section using applicator units. Voith’s new SupremeFilm roll cover works well in the Voith Speed Sizer AT, and is also suitable for challenging applications in film presses produced by other manufacturers.

Körber Group expands Business Area Tissue with Brazilian embossing roll specialist Roll-Tec

The international technology group Körber acquires Roll-Tec Cilindro Ltda. based in São Paulo, Brazil. Roll-Tec develops, produces and sells engraving cylinders for embossing machines for tissue paper and other tissue products. The acquisition was completed effective July 31, 2019.

World’s most modern board machine successfully commissioned at BillerudKorsnäs in Gruvön

On June 28, 2019, the BM 7, the “most modern, most efficient and largest board machine in the world”, was successfully commissioned at the BillerudKorsnäs production facility in Gruvön, Sweden. The Voith XcelLine board machine has been equipped with a pioneering technological setup that sets new performance benchmarks for production lines for four different board grades. At a design speed of 1,200 m/min and web width of 8,800 mm, the capacity of the BM 7 is 550,000 metric tons per year. Start-up took just seven days from stock on wire to paper on reel.

Metso expands its valve distributor network with eight partners in Europe

Metso signed new distributor agreements in eight European countries for its valve business during H1/2019. The new agreements help to further expand the coverage of Metso’s valve offering in various customer industries. Depending on the country, the distributors serve process industries, such as refineries, petrochemical, chemical, fertilizer, steel, bioenergy, food, power, pulp and paper, and waste water. Some of the distributors also provide service support for Metso valves and valve controls.

BTG as a key partner for digital transformation to the pulp and paper industry

Kartogroup has selected the BTG dataPARC solution as their process information platform for their tissue mill located in Burriana, in the Castellón province of Spain. The mill is part of the Cominter Group, headquartered in Barcelona. This is the second tissue mill in the organization to select dataPARC.

Stora Enso to sell its stake in the Dawang paper mill to its joint venture partner Huatai

Stora Enso has signed an agreement to divest its 60% equity stake in the Dawang Mill in China, to its joint venture partner, Shandong Huatai Paper. The joint venture Stora Enso Huatai (Shandong) Paper Company Limited operates the Dawang paper mill at Dongying in Shandong province in China. The mill has an annual production capacity of 140 000 tonnes of super-calendered (SC) magazine paper and other publication paper grades based on recovered fibre.

Metsä Spring invests in Woodio, leader in waterproof wood composite technology

Metsä Group’s innovation company Metsä Spring Ltd has made an equity investment in Woodio Ltd, a leading developer of waterproof wood composite products. The financing round totals approximately EUR 4 million, and Metsä Spring participates in the round together with current investors Ardent Venture BV, Finow Ltd, NextStone Ltd and Valve Ventures Ltd.

Viscose Speciality Fibres against fraud with Organic Cotton

Alexander Bachmann, Business Manager at Kelheim Fibres, will present a detectable viscose fibre with a unique fingerprint structure at this year’s Global Fiber Congress in Dornbirn. With this fibre, the Bavarian viscose speciality fibre manufacturer addresses a global problem of growing proportions: For organic cotton alone, the rapidly increasing demand with simultaneously declining production volume invite fraud and counterfeiting, but also other high-quality textiles are forged on a grand scale.
